The contest begins, and the oden's soup proves to be too hot to eat. Kirby is not at all disheartened: he enjoys the soup as a hot tub while munching on oden. He farts in the oden bowl, prompting all contestants except Storo to escape. Once reminded about the Dream Bowl, Kirby gets serious and gains the [[Fighter]] ability, enabling his fighting spirit to devour more oden. The Squeaks are concerned that Storo will lose, but Daroach explains that he was simply a decoy to distract the audience, and they prepare to steal the Dream Bowl. However, their escape is sabotaged due to Fighter Kirby's long headband getting stuck to the Dream Bowl, which results in him getting dragged along. The Squeaks are blown away when Kirby releases the headband. Kirby runs back with the Dream Bowl, but by the time he's back, Storo is announced as the winner. Daroach gloats, but then finds the Dream Bowl to have been emptied by Kirby, who ate its contents on the way because he got hungry.
